S90s - A tone of their own!

Anyone whos spoken to us over the past few years regarding pickups will probably know very well how highly we rate Alnico 3 magnets - and with the hugely popular T90s and Classic 50s Deluxes causing waves of their own, it only seemed right to introduce a single coil using these cracking little magnets!

The “neck” pickup is the most traditional of the bunch, and the model we’d recommend for this slot in most setups – its big and warm, but is lacking in that creamy “chime” you’d associate with most single coils. Certainly not one for the purists, but incredibly usable if you’re looking to get a lot out of your guitar.

The "middle", is a touch spicier then the neck pickup, thick, muscular, aggressive and ideal for harder blues and rock players.

The bridge is the show piece in the set for us – it’s big, its blisteringly hot, it goes like a steam train – and most importantly, it sounds absolutely nothing like a Strat®!

Supplied with cover (choice of colour) and screws (choice of colour) and springs as standard, and with a few little extra options to really help you nail the tone your chasing.

I've used strat pups from many of the major manufacturers. But for this hotrod '54 build, I wanted to give it some punk attitude and thought, axesrus do a S90 if I remember...nice and cheap too. Fitted them last night and plugged it into a Marshall and smiled. You all know what I'm talking about. You don't even know you're doing it! 25 mins later, your face hurts from smiling, we've all been there. I REALLY like the drive tone. I've got a set of the Axesrus Texas Blues in my '66 build which is nice and stratty, but sometimes you gotta have 4 chord 2 minute punk songs and this totally nailed it! Really enjoying the tone.
